Cheers to Belgian Beers (30-April-2011)

April 26, 2011 by Dave Leave a Comment

Cheers to Belgian BeersThe 5th Annual Cheers to Belgian Beers takes place Saturday, April 30, 2011 at Metalcraft Fabrication (723 N Tillamook). The fest goes from noon to 9pm (so arrive early, enjoy delicious beer, and then head to the Timbers match at 7:30pm!).

Every beer available during the fest has been brewed with the Wyeast 3787 Trappist High Gravity yeast strain. Each brewery, via dart toss, was assigned color and strength characteristics to aim for, so some of the brewers are out of their comfort zones. For beer styles, this is my favorite local beer festival (i.e. beers aren’t all IPAs!). The beers are truly experimental, and no doubt there will be some fantastic discoveries (and also possibly a few stinkers).

$15 gets you the tasting goblet (required to taste) and five drink tickets (additional tastes are a buck each).
